Recall & Review
beginner
What is the purpose of full route cache in Next.js?
Full route cache stores the entire rendered page output so that subsequent requests can be served instantly without re-rendering, improving performance and reducing server load.
Click to reveal answer
intermediate
How does Next.js implement full route caching with the App Router?
Next.js uses server components and static rendering to cache the full HTML output of routes. When a route is requested again, the cached HTML is served directly unless invalidated.
Click to reveal answer
intermediate
What triggers invalidation of the full route cache in Next.js?
Cache invalidation happens when data changes, server actions run, or when developers manually configure revalidation times, ensuring users see fresh content.
Click to reveal answer
advanced
Explain the difference between full route cache and partial caching in Next.js.
Full route cache stores the entire page output, serving it instantly. Partial caching caches only parts of the page or data, requiring some rendering on each request.
Click to reveal answer
beginner
Why is full route caching beneficial for SEO and user experience in Next.js?
Because cached pages load very fast and serve fully rendered HTML, search engines can index content easily and users get instant page loads, improving SEO and experience.
Click to reveal answer
What does full route cache store in Next.js?
✗ Incorrect
Full route cache stores the entire rendered HTML output of a route to serve it instantly on subsequent requests.
When is the full route cache invalidated in Next.js?
✗ Incorrect
Cache invalidation occurs when underlying data changes or when configured revalidation times expire to keep content fresh.
Which Next.js feature helps create full route cache?
✗ Incorrect
Server Components combined with static rendering enable Next.js to cache full route HTML output.
How does full route caching improve SEO?
✗ Incorrect
Serving fully rendered HTML fast helps search engines index pages better, improving SEO.
What is a key difference between full route cache and partial caching?
✗ Incorrect
Full route cache saves the whole page output, while partial caching saves only some parts or data.
Describe how full route caching works in Next.js and why it matters.
Think about what is saved and how it affects loading speed and search engines.
You got /5 concepts.
Explain the difference between full route cache and partial caching in Next.js with examples.
Consider how much of the page is cached and when each is useful.
You got /4 concepts.